B Buttons

For the purpose of focusing the camera,
pressing either of the

B buttons has the

same effect as pressing the shutter-release
button halfway; note, however, that vibration
reduction (available with VR lenses) can only
be engaged by pressing the shutter-release
button halfway.

Predictive Focus Tracking

In continuous-servo AF, the camera will initiate predictive focus tracking
if the subject moves toward or away from the camera while the shutter-
release button is pressed halfway or either of the

B buttons is

pressed.

This allows the camera to track focus while attempting to

predict where the subject will be when the shutter is released.
